When YS Jagan Mohan Reddy came to power in 2019, after the YSRCP won with a staggering majority, Jagan announced that he would be reshuffling his cabinet after two and half years, so that the power would be balancing out. This reshuffling was supposed to have happened six months ago, but Jagan postponed it.
As a result, a lot of the members of the YSRCP have been eyeing various ministerial posts in the cabinet all this time. In the last six months, especially, they have been trying their best, to bag these posts. Those who are already ministers have been trying their best to retain their posts, by being more active and doing more in their constituencies.
It is now being said that Jagan has decided not to reshuffle the cabinet at all, due to the current situations in the state, with so many protests and employee agitations in the state. He is said to be of the opinion that reshuffling the cabinet would create further problems for the government, leaving all the ministerial aspirants highly disappointed. With so many members left disappointed, it is now to be seen how this will impact the YSRCP’s future.
